Early Life and Career

Karl Malone was born on July 24, 1963, in Summerfield, Louisiana. He was the seventh of nine children born to Shirley and Shedrick Malone. Malone's father left the family when he was young, and his mother worked multiple jobs to support her children. Malone found solace in basketball, and he quickly developed into a standout player.

Malone attended Summerfield High School, where he led the Bulldogs to three state championships. He was recruited to play for Louisiana Tech University, where he became one of the most dominant players in college basketball. In 1985, he was selected by the Utah Jazz with the 13th overall pick in the NBA draft.

NBA Career

Malone quickly became a star in the NBA. He was a powerful scorer and rebounder, and he helped the Jazz become one of the most successful teams in the league. In 1997, Malone led the Jazz to the NBA Finals, where they lost to the Chicago Bulls in six games. Malone was named the NBA MVP that season, and he was also named to the All-NBA First Team 11 times and the All-NBA Defensive First Team 8 times.

Malone retired from the NBA in 2004 after 19 seasons. He finished his career with 36,928 points, which is second only to Kareem Abdul-Jabbar on the NBA's all-time scoring list. Malone was inducted into the Naismith Memorial Basketball Hall of Fame in 2010.

Legacy

Karl Malone is widely considered to be one of the greatest power forwards to ever play the game. He was a physical specimen with a relentless work ethic. He was also a skilled scorer and rebounder, and he was one of the best defenders in the league. Malone's legacy as one of the greatest players in NBA history is secure.

Personal Life

Karl Malone is married to Kay Kinsey, and they have four children. Malone is a devout Mormon, and he is actively involved in his community. He is the founder of the Karl Malone Foundation, which supports programs for disadvantaged children.
